The Benefits of a Washer and are Washer dryers any good Dryer Combo

Many households find washer dryer combos to be an ideal choice. They are smaller than standalone units and can be positioned in a small space like an alcove or closet.

They don't need vents, which makes them safer to use and less likely to catch fire. They are however more complicated than standalone units, and can cost more to run.

Space Savings

Combinations of washer and dryer combine two distinct laundry appliances into one unit. They take up a quarter of the space a washer and dryer set occupies which makes them perfect for small homes, townhomes apartments, condos, townhomes and other spaces in which space is limited. Even when you don't have a lot of space, a combination of washer and dryer is a good option. It will save you time and money by streamlining your laundry routine.

Unlike standalone washers and dryers with a variety of kinds of connections, a combination washer-dryer has only one type of connection. This means you will only require one hose for water to and from your machine, and one outlet to supply power to it. This is ideal for those who use tanks or are concerned about the impact on the environment of their lifestyle. It helps conserve both water and energy.

Combination machines are designed to be less harsh on your clothes than front-loading washing machines. The horizontal axis drum gently lowers clothes back into the water after lifting them several times. This is a lot like the motion of a washboard. Because of this, they require less water and detergent than front-load washers but still give a thorough clean.

Drying is also a more delicate process with these units. When drying, they use either cold or warm water in order to cool the air inside the drum. Then the condensation and moisture are removed. This method of drying is far more gentle on your clothes than the hot-air agitation used in most standard dryers.

Depending on the model you select, your combo washer and dryer may come with additional features to further enhance the laundry experience. For instance some models come with built-in wifi capabilities which allow you to connect to the machine using an app on your smartphone or tablet to monitor the progress of your laundry. Some models have an antimicrobial treatment on the dispenser, gasket, and draining system to prevent mold and bacteria from growing in these areas.

Energy Savings

A washer and dryer combo can transform your laundry routine by eliminating one of the most troublesome chores. This appliance allows you to wash and dry your clothes, towels and linens in one easy step. No need to switch between drying and washing appliances. This two-in one appliance is perfect for those who live in apartments or smaller homes that want to maximize their space and save time.

No matter if you're a renter or homeowner, having a washer and dryer combination can save you money on energy bills in the long run. This is because these appliances consume less water and energy than standalone dryers and washing machines. Most modern washer-dryer combinations have high spin speeds that allow you to dry your clothes and fabrics in a fraction of the time of a traditional dryer.

The majority of combo units do not need a duct to move air. This helps your home stay cleaner and more comfortable, and also helps to protect the environment. The washer-dryer combination is also more secure than vented drying systems, because they don't have to be located near flammable materials such as lint.

The downside to washer-dryer combinations is that they are less powerful and have longer drying times than standalone washing machines. This can be a problem for large families that have lots of laundry. If you are able to overcome the limitations, a combo washer and dryer is a great choice for your family.

Since a single unit is responsible for both washing and drying the motor in the washer-dryer combination is always working. This can lead to it wearing out more quickly than an individual unit. You can extend the life of your machine by keeping it clean, and not over-loading it.

Also, be aware that drying capacity of many combo units is only about half of their capacity for washing. You'll need to cut your washing load by half to achieve optimal drying. If you have a large family or heavy load of laundry, it could be better for you to buy a separate washing machine and dryer instead of a combination washer and dryer.

Convenience

Washer dryer combos are becoming increasingly popular with many consumers, especially those who live in small apartments or spaces. They take up less space than a standard washer and clothes dryer, and can be connected directly to drains instead an external air vent. Some models have integrated drying functions, making them more convenient to use.

Aside from their size and ease of hooking up, washer dryer combos are renowned for their energy efficiency. They consume less water and spin at a faster speed than standalone units. This helps remove more moisture from the clothes prior to starting the drying cycle. Many manufacturers now offer a range of models with varying load capacities which means you can choose the perfect machine for your requirements and budget.

The slow drying cycles of combo washer dryers are among their major disadvantages. These machines can dry a load of laundry in more than three hours, which is much longer than most standalone dryers. While the lengthy drying time isn't a major issue for most people, it is important to consider when selecting this kind of appliance.

Washer dryer combinations, with the exception for drying, are very similar to separate washing machines. They provide a range of features and a large selection. Certain models come with smart sensors, sanitize cycles and steam settings that ensure your clothes are clean and fresh every time you use them. Other models have smaller designs that fit in confined areas like under a counter or a closet.

Overall, washer dryer combos are a great option for households who need a convenient method to wash and dry laundry. Their size and ease of use make them suitable for smaller homes, apartments, condos, and other urban properties. However, if you have many children and would like to dry and wash larger loads at the at the same time, you might prefer standalone appliances. In addition, if you have mobility issues that prevent you from lifting heavy objects, a traditional standalone washing machine may be a better option for you.
